Output 8052a2c67755a73cfe43fe3e85d6d616053f55eb058381cf4e4252e4c220067e:1

value
760535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37525d250affe339c30993fc63b9969240aa9 OP_EQUAL
address
3BMEXR9UdAqjzZyxD9hF57YVhi7MGgtsQZ
transaction
8052a2c67755a73cfe43fe3e85d6d616053f55eb058381cf4e4252e4c220067e
confirmations
332784
spent
true